I am a RED SEAL Journeyman Ticketed Electrician in Canada, so maybe I can explain how to harness the electricity a bit. If there is electricity to be gotten from Greens Motor... the magnet in the middle of the device needs to be attached to a rotor. See how generators work here...

http://www.physclips.unsw.edu.au/jw/electricmotors.html

Now to my knowledge... the only problem with Greens motor that I can see, is that it would require almost no friction. It would most likely work a lot like a wind generator, except it would be in a vertical position.

What I would do... is on the other end of the rotor I would have magnets. And around those magnets I would have coils. Those coils would ha ve alternate current, from induction.... from the magnet rotating in them. The process is the same as those flash lights you shake to get light.

Here is the CATCH! There is resistance when moving a magnet near a coil. Aswell there is resistance from the bearings... because the rotor needs to be attached to something. So Greens motor would have to be strong enough to move past both of these resistances. I have been thinking about building one...
